You typically create a DC power supply from the low frequency, and use that to run a high frequency oscillator and amplifier. If there needs to be a relationship between frequency in and frequency out, often there is a divider running on the high frequency side in combination with a phase locked loop synching up to the low frequency side.
All amplifier typically exhibit a band-pass frequency response. The cut off frequency in the low end is usually determined by the coupling band bypass capacitor .and the high frequency limit is typically determined by internal capacitances in the transistor itself.
High frequency is used because of the the size of antennas used to transmit and receive the communications signal. The higher the frequency the smaller the antenna.
Depends on what you mean by high frequency. The rabbit ears antenna used in broadcast TV is a dipole and is used for VHF.

The frequency is likely a "birdie" on the second scanner -- meaning that the scanner circuitry produces a signal noise. This is common, and many scanner manuals provide a list of "birdie" frequencies.

Then enter the channel number where you want to store a frequency, then press Func and Pgm. The channel number appears.2. Use the number keys and to enter the frequency (including the decimal point) you want to store.3. Press E to store the frequency into the channel. Notes:• If you entered an invalid frequency in Step 2, Error appears and the scanner beeps three times. Enter a valid frequency.• The scanner automatically rounds the entered number to the nearest valid frequency. For example, if you enter 151.473 (MHz), your scanner accepts it as 151.475.• When you enter a frequency into a channel, the scanner automatically turns on the delay function and DLY appears. When delay is turned on, the scanner automatically pauses scanning2 seconds after the end of a transmission before scanning proceeds to the next channel. To turn the function off or on, press Func + Dly.• If you enter a frequency that has already been entered elsewhere, the scanner sounds an error tone and displays the channel that was duplicated. If you entered the frequency by mis- take, press then enter the correct frequency. To enter the frequency anyway, press E to accept.4. To program the next channel in sequence, press E then repeat Steps 2 and 3.
